Fancy a change from traditional Czech bread ( excellent and varied though it is)?then pay a visit to the Pekarna Balkan at Cejl 105 (near the tram stop for Inter Spar).
As the name suggests the owners hail from Southern Europe and have brought their baking skills with them. They make a good stab at bread, rolls, pastries, pizza, burek and so on all made from doughs which are distinctly non- Czech.
There are a few tables and chairs as they also serve coffee and theoretically breakfast.
Not the most glamorous location in town but welcoming, tasty and inexpensive.
